10 Vain Quarterbacks Who Loved the Mirror as Much as the Playbook

There’s nothing wrong with a little self-confidence, especially at the quarterback position. But some guys took it to another level—treating the mirror like a second huddle and spending just as much time fixing their hair as reading defenses.

These quarterbacks loved the spotlight almost as much as they loved throwing touchdowns. Whether it was perfectly styled hair, designer suits, or a flair for drama, these signal-callers made vanity part of their game plan.

Broadway Joe basically invented the swagger era for quarterbacks. He wore fur coats, posed in pantyhose, and still found time to win a Super Bowl.
